  • In this video I demonstrate how to do a square package lashing. I also demonstrate a reinforced version using crossing knots which add strength and stability to the lashing.
    This lashing is demonstrated in the ABoK as #2086.
    All in all, this is a super useful lashing both for sending out packages, moving packages around and even decorating a gift with!
